Walk | A bushwalk of any kind short or long(NEW!!!) Grade: Easy/Medium. This walk takes you to several secluded beaches on the northern headland of Jervis Bay which is used by the Australian Navy. From Honeymoon Bay we will follow the track to Target Beach and then walk to the far end of the beach. On our return journey we will visit the viewing platform above Longnose Point. We then descend to the rocks below to see the wreck of the St Martin De Porres and return to Honeymoon Bay. Please bring morning tea, lunch & afternoon tea. Limit:15.
